One effective hack is to utilize a wall-mounted cutting mat holder. This clever solution frees up valuable desktop space while keeping your mat within easy reach. Alternatively, consider repurposing an old picture frame or wall-mounted shelf to store frequently used scissors, tape measures, and other essential tools. By elevating these items, you'll maintain a clear and clutter-free surface while keeping your most-used items at hand.
Another clever strategy is to integrate your cutting mat into a multi-functional workspace.
